![]() Nissan IDx Nismo Shows Up in Jay Leno’s Garage - By Jeff Perez Since Leno is out of a job, he now has more time to spend working on his YouTube hit series “Jay Leno’s Garage.” We’ve seen the wild and the wonderful in his garage before, but now the Nissan Idx Nismo made its way to Beverly Hills. Originally introduced in Tokyo, the IDx is likely to be a sporty new coupe in the Nissan lineup if produced. And being a spiritual successor to the Datsun 510, it brings back a sense of nostalgia and design that we all love. Now, Leno gets his chance behind the wheel. Watch it below: |
